The Oven Door Gasket is an OEM part for GE ovens. It creates a seal between the oven door and the oven frame, preventing heat from escaping during cooking. This gasket is essential for maintaining consistent oven temperatures, which ensures even cooking and energy efficiency.

You should replace the oven door gasket if it becomes worn or damaged. Common causes of a bad gasket include repeated exposure to high temperatures, normal wear and tear, or physical damage from cleaning or accidental impacts. A compromised gasket can lead to heat loss, uneven cooking, and increased energy consumption.

Symptoms of a bad oven door gasket include:

  • Heat escaping from around the oven door
  • Longer cooking times or unevenly cooked food
  • Visible cracks, tears, or deformation in the gasket
  • The oven door not closing properly

This GE replacement part is also compatible with Hotpoint, RCA, and some Kenmore models.

The Window Pack Assembly is an OEM part for GE ranges and ovens. It serves as the inner glass component of the oven door, allowing you to observe the cooking process while providing insulation and protection. It consists of an inner glass panel, frame, and seals to ensure proper insulation and prevent heat loss.

Causes of a faulty window pack assembly can include accidental impact, cracks, or damage to the inner glass panel or frame. These factors can compromise the visibility, insulation, and safety of the oven.

Symptoms of a bad window pack assembly may include:

  • Cracked or shattered inner glass panel
  • Impaired visibility into the oven cavity
  • Heat loss or inadequate insulation

This OEM GE part can also be used on Hotpoint, RCA, and Kenmore/Sears appliances.
